Computing and IT - not sure whether to apply. Any help?

I'm thinking about applying for a Cert HE in computing with the OU for February, but my time limit for deciding is growing shorter and I'm honestly not sure what to do. I currently work around 30-35 hours per week on a varying shift basis, so some days, some nights and I'm not sure whether I'll have enough time to study, or whether I'll actually be able to keep up with the work load.

I'm 21 now and have been out of education since I was 17, as I dropped out of a computing BTEC in college because of depression. Since then I've done nothing in the way of study and I'm just wondering how many hours per week I'd have to set aside each week. I know the guideline is 16 hours for 60 credits per year, which is what I'd be doing, but is there anybody here who's actually done this course? I've heard varying opinions on this. Tu100 in the first year module I believe.

Any input would be appreciated because right now the idea scares the living hell out of me. I'm fairly competent with computers as far as hardware and software go, but programming is still relatively new to me, so I imagine these components would eat into my time more than anything else. :frown:

On average I doubt I've spent near 16 hours a week studying for 90 credits. Sure, the weeks around deadlines and exams I might sometimes have done 20 hours of work a week, but there were plenty of weeks where I did absolutely nothing. I worked 37-40 hours a week throughout my whole degree, studying 90 credits for 3 years and 60 in my final year. TU100 is fairly basic so if you already are pretty comfortable with computers I reckon you'll be fine. You only need to get 40% to pass, remember. There isn't much programming in TU100 as far as I'm aware, and certainly nothing too complex.
